A novel difunctional DNA-nanogold (AuNP) dendrimer with a hemin-G-quadruplex was for the first time utilized as the nanotag for the in situ amplified electronic signal for nucleic acid detection by coupling high efficiency DNAzyme with the intercalated methylene blue (MB).
